Frequently Asked Questions

What are the typical salary ranges for Bilingual positions by seniority?
Junior bilingual roles start around $55,000–$70,000 annually. Mid‑level positions range $70,000–$100,000, while senior specialists earn $100,000–$150,000. Lead or managerial roles can exceed $150,000, especially in high‑growth fintech or AI firms.
Which skills and certifications are most valuable for Bilingual tech roles?
Proficiency in at least two languages (e.g., English‑Spanish, English‑Mandarin), expertise with CAT tools like SDL Trados, Memsource, or Lokalise, and experience in Jira or Confluence for localization workflows. Certifications such as ATA Certified Translator, Microsoft LSP, or Google Cloud Translation API developer add measurable credibility.
How common is remote work for Bilingual tech positions?
Over 70% of bilingual listings allow full‑time remote work. Companies such as Atlassian, GitHub, and Zendesk offer distributed teams where bilingual staff manage global support, localization, and product communication from any timezone.
What career progression paths exist for bilingual professionals in tech?
A bilingual career can start with support or QA, move to Localization Lead, then to Product Manager or Technical Program Manager, and ultimately to Director of Global Product or Chief Language Officer in large enterprises.
What are the current industry trends affecting Bilingual tech jobs?
AI‑driven translation platforms, increased focus on multilingual UX writing, rapid localization for mobile apps, and compliance with GDPR and other regional data laws all raise demand for bilingual specialists who can manage both language and technical quality.
